Dual portrait of Margaret and Mary Tudor. Margaret became Queen of Scotland by her marriage to James IV. Her reign, after the death of James in battle, was a stormy one. Mary, on the other hand, lived a pampered life amid the courts of France and was called the "Tudor Rose." Genealogy chart on endpapers.
